    Three weeks isn't enough. Three years isn't enough.

    Keep your eyes open, watch how others secure, don't follow too close, don't stand near a crane doing a lift, don't scratch the paint, carry spray cans in JD green, Cat yellow, CASEIH red, don't cut the straps use edge protectors, don't stand beside a load of pipe when you unstrap it, belly wrap, know the securement rules, GOAL, inspect your truck and load often.....even when you're walking back from the restaraunt.......never stop learning, watching, listening.

    Do all of that and when something goes wrong at least it won't be a catastrophe.
